This was such a diverse eating experience! We ate manapua, balut, adobo pork, duck, pork belly, poke, fresh ahi, octopus, and so much fruit (mangosteen, mangos, longans, durian, soursop, and passionfruit). If you’re an adventurous eater this is definitely for you. Side note - was sick the day before and the tour guide (victor) was incredible. He offered me alternatives that were easier for me to handle (e.g., congee), got me ginger ale, and to go bags for every single stop so I wouldn’t miss out on the experience. If you’re looking for something unique and delicious definitely go on this tour!

A great way to see Chinatown food offerings. Victor is a gracious, attentive guide and remarkable ambassador for Hawai’i, the history and its many cultures. And, what a handsome Dude. He remembered everyone’s name from the start. He knew the vendors we visited and many others we passed. The stops were timely and organized. Victor made sure we all got the supplies we needed to eat each food, carrying an abundant supply of wet wipes for our hands. At each stop, there was a generous serving of each food or dish to try. Victor and the vendors had lids and plastic bags to use for leftovers. With 16 stops, there was plenty of food! The sliced tuna was buttery and almost melted in your mouth. The roast duck and pork so flavorful, the steamed buns were tender & dry, stuffed with moist & tender pork or wild boar. My favorite stop was the fruit stand where we had both more familiar and less familiar fruits: from mango & papaya to soursop, mangosteen & longans. We finished with poke and the bright green Vietnamese Pandan Cake. A great experience with a lovely guide to make it even better!
